Output 7a3154acbebb9719b71b527ae80b6d279c75a15b33b4b8a67a75dede8a37e438:27

value
393364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40f130c2ed77f6b6d3cd7e1492ea6b56421f4f66 OP_EQUAL
address
37cQ72dJh5HA9L9CCSDby9QryQM7GXFYus
transaction
7a3154acbebb9719b71b527ae80b6d279c75a15b33b4b8a67a75dede8a37e438
confirmations
275268
spent
true